Book The Physics of Warm Nuclei

Download or read book The Physics of Warm Nuclei written by Helmut Hofmann and published by OUP Oxford. This book was released on 2008-04-17 with total page 648 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book offers a comprehensive survey of basic elements of nuclear dynamics at low energies and discusses similarities to mesoscopic systems. It addresses systems with finite excitations of their internal degrees of freedom, so that their collective motion exhibits features typical for transport processes in small and isolated systems. The importance of quantum aspects is examined with respect to both the microscopic damping mechanism and the nature of the transport equations. The latter must account for the fact that the collective motion is self-sustained. This implies highly nonlinear couplings between internal and collective degrees of freedom —- different to assumptions made in treatments known in the literature. A critical discussion of the use of thermal concepts is presented. The book can be considered self-contained. It presents existing models, theories and theoretical tools, both from nuclear physics and other fields, which are relevant to an understanding of the observed physical phenomena.

Book Nuclei and Mesoscopic Physics

Download or read book Nuclei and Mesoscopic Physics written by Pawel Danielewicz and published by American Institute of Physics. This book was released on 2008-04-17 with total page 254 pages. Available in PDF, EPUB and Kindle. Book excerpt: Mesoscopic physics unifies physical systems “in between” microworld and macroworld. Such systems are sufficiently large to reveal certain statistical regularities, but they are sufficiently small to allow physicists to study, both theoretically and experimentally, individual quantum states. The conference covers common and specific features of those systems (nuclei, complex atoms and molecules, atomic traps, sold state micro- and nano-devices, prototypes of future quantum computers). This young field is rapidly developing opening new ideas and technological breakthroughs.

Book Mesoscopic Physics of Electrons and Photons

Download or read book Mesoscopic Physics of Electrons and Photons written by Eric Akkermans and published by Cambridge University Press. This book was released on 2007-05-28 with total page 479 pages. Available in PDF, EPUB and Kindle. Book excerpt: Quantum mesoscopic physics covers a whole class in interference effects related to the propagation of waves in complex and random media. These effects are ubiquitous in physics, from the behaviour of electrons in metals and semiconductors to the propagation of electromagnetic waves in suspensions such as colloids, and quantum systems like cold atomic gases. A solid introduction to quantum mesoscopic physics, this book is a modern account of the problem of coherent wave propagation in random media. It provides a unified account of the basic theoretical tools and methods, highlighting the common aspects of the various optical and electronic phenomena involved and presenting a large number of experimental results. With over 200 figures, and exercises throughout, the book was originally published in 2007 and is ideal for graduate students in physics, electrical engineering, applied physics, acoustics and astrophysics. It will also be an interesting reference for researchers.
